Lower Electrical Load: A smaller refrigeration system requires
a smaller electrical load. Both the Vehere and the HI-E DRY 195
draw only twelve amps of electricity
and plug into a 115 volt 20 amp
outlet, providing all the humidity
control necessary for a 450 square
foot pool at ASHRAE standards (82°F air temp, 80°F water
temp, 60% relative humidity).

QUIET-VENT™ Ventilation System

Ventilation is also an important element of the HI-E DRY
pool room dehumidi- fication system. Ventilation should adhere
to all local codes. At minimum a simple negative (exhaust)
pressure ventilation system should be used. This ventilation
system is operated independently of the HI-E DRY unit
and keeps the concentrations of corrosive pool chemicals
to a minimum and keeps moisture from penetrating the
rest of the structure.
